The top of the backboard for a regulation height goal is like 14 feet. Realistically speaking, nobody is getting that high.

Take a dude like Vince, he's 6'5? He had 44 or so in his prime. He can get his head slightly above the rim, the top of the backboard is another 4 feet up.
You have to add in arm span as well, using the length of arm starting at equal point on head to the fingertips. The person's arm(s) will add another 16-30" (guesstimate using my arm measurement) when reaching up, hence reaching higher on a backboard. A goal is 120" off the floor, the backboard measures 36" in height (but only 30" from top of goal), so a max height of 150" off floor. Vince would stand 77", plus a 44" jump, plus an arm reach of let's say 24", for a total reach of 145", which is only 5" below the top of backboard, although that's just math and a not an exact measurement. Vince didn't reach that height that I'm aware of but he may very well have/could have. There would be an alteration of maximum reach by how the individual jumps and angles the body, uses one arm (higher reach) or both arms (lessens reach), and force exerted plays a massive role.
